    I have 2 th9 accounts. One coming from a near max 8 (3/4 skulls & de spells left) and the second coming from a max 7 then skipped 8. I have no regrets on either decision. If this is your first account, then you should spend some time at 8. Build up troops and learn how to do the various styles of hogging, gowipe, and valk based attacks. Doing this helped me immensely when I created my second account. If you choose to rush don't go until your elixer based stuff, especially de drills and storage, are done. Gibarch and loons must be at lvl 5 before go as well. This will take you a month. Morgauth, Sin of Dusk, and Sservis all have excellent resources to help you. Good luck and happy clashing!

    TH8 is a transition level, where you really need to start getting into the strategy of attacks toward the end. There is a big difference between a TH7/new TH8 and a max TH8. I think you're going to struggle if you try to skip it.

    I'm a looner, and have a TH9 with lev 6 loons, and a TH8 with level 5 loons. Level 6 loons are great, but level 5 loons are pretty good as well, especially against weaker TH8 bases. I would stick with them for a while at least.
